they do this all the time. There is a rural town somewhere on the east coast the Green Berets train at and the whole town is involved. One are rebels, others as friendly townsfolk.
 
When I was in the 82d we would do this kind of stuff all the time, in many different states. Sometimes we were the good guys, sometimes the aggressors. federal training areas are great for ranges and such, but you can't stay mission ready to meet every contingency just using federal areas. Sometimes you have to go off base. I wound up retiring in Washington because we did a similar exercise here and I feel in love with the area. I'm not ready to sandbag the house on this one.
